How Do You Make Monogrammed Coffee Tumblers?

What used to be an expensive, time consuming project is now an easy craft you can make at home, thanks to the invention of some new products. Personalized coffee tumblers make great gifts for your favorite coffee drinkers, and with the use of porcelain paint markers, the entire project takes about an hour from start to finish. Add the cups to a gift basket for a wedding shower or give a few to the new neighbors who just moved in next door.

Paint markers can be used to write or paint beautiful pictures, and they are dishwasher safe. Use a stencil or draw the monogram freehand on the mug using the paint markers. Depending upon the taste of the person you are making the mug for, you may wish to go with fancy lettering or block lettering.

Without preheating the oven, place the mug inside. Then turn the oven on to 300 degrees. The ceramic tumbler cannot take fast changes in temperature, and it could break if placed directly into a hot oven.
